Inside the BeatBot an Arduino reads 9 infrared sensors for line detection at 100 samples a second. A digital servo controls the Ackerman steering mechanism to follow the line on the track or floor.

But the BeatBot is a programmable, self-driving, line-following robot made to push runners by giving them a real visual target to beat. Kind of like dog racing for humans.
